Good morning. He plays jazz with a Telecaster. I have a 2.1mm 12th fret action. Is it correct that I have too little? Thank you
@NicholasRussell
4 ай бұрын
Hello, I will have to measure what this Tele is currently reading at the 12th fret. I do not know from memory. Here in Canada we go by 64th's of an inch on most guitars when determining 12th fret action height. For Classical guitars, maybe people prefer measurements in mm. What is 'correct' is hard to determine. The measurement at the 12th fret is only one of the components of an ideal or correct set up. You would also have to consider neck relief, height of nut slot, height of saddle(s), string gauge and also your playing style. Thanks for listening!
